For many of my K-2 special education students, puzzles provide more than just a fun activity-they are a powerful tool for growth across multiple areas of learning and development.\r\n\r\nPuzzles help students strengthen important problem-solving abilities. As they look for matching pieces, turn to fit, and complete images, they are practicing logical thinking, spatial awareness, and perserverance. These are the same critical thinking skills they need to approach reading, math, and STEM challenges.\r\n\r\nPlacing puzzle pieces requires careful hand-eye coordination and finger strength. This fine motor practice supports handwriting, scissor use, and other classroom tasks where precise control is essential.\r\n\r\nWorking on puzzles together fosters cooperation and communication. My students encoure one another, share strategies, and celebrate each small success. For many of my students, puzzles provide a clear achievable challend. Finishing a puzzle brings a sense of accomplishment that boosts self-esteem and helps them to believe, \"I can do hard things.\"","fullyFundedDate":1738795411216,"projectUrl":"project/piece-by-piece-building-bright-minds-wi/9051490/","projectTitle":"Piece by Piece: Building Bright Minds With Puzzles","teacherDisplayName":"Ms. Brandon","teacherPhotoUrl":"https://storage.donorschoose.net/dc_prod/images/teacher/profile/orig/tp9363241_orig.jpg?crop=1846,1846,x0,y6&width=272&height=272&fit=bounds&auto=webp&t=1705187594655","teacherClassroomUrl":"classroom/9363241"},{"teacherId":5384429,"projectId":9200833,"letterContent":"Thank you so much for all the new amazing resources in our classroom. About this school
Mission Ave Elementary School is
an urban public school
in Albuquerque, New Mexico that is part of Albuquerque Public Schools.
It serves 350 students
in grades Pre-K - 5 with a student/teacher ratio of 14.6:1.
Its teachers have had 109 projects funded on DonorsChoose.
